FSI presents a stable but mediocre Piotroski F-Score of 4/9, yet it is fundamentally disconnected from its valuation metrics. The stock trades at $6.58, representing a massive premium over its Graham Number ($2.04) and Intrinsic Value ($0.42). With negative operating margins (-1.20%), stagnant revenue growth (-0.50%), and a dismal earnings track record (0/4 beats in the last year), the current price is speculative. This bearish outlook is further reinforced by aggressive insider selling by the CEO and a technical trend score of 0/100.
ZKIN presents a classic value trap profile, characterized by a stable but mediocre Piotroski F-Score of 4/9 and a complete absence of positive growth catalysts. While the stock trades at a deep discount to book value (P/B 0.43), this is offset by a catastrophic year-over-year revenue decline of 43.50% and negative profitability across all key margins. The technical trend is entirely bearish (0/100), and the lack of analyst coverage or dividend support suggests a high-risk speculative environment.
